Carcinogenic hazard in the manufacture of technical-grade carbon
Troitskaia, N.A.; Velichkovskiĭ, B.T.; Kogan, F.M.; Kuz'minykh, A.I.
Voprosy Onkologii 26(1): 63-67
1980
ISSN/ISBN: 0507-3758 PMID: 7355600 Document Number: 165606
As a result of retrospective studies on cancer mortality among workers engaged in the carbon black industry, it was found that the mortality rate from cancer of the lung, stomach and gastrointestinal tract within this cohort of workers is higher compared with the population of the surrounding district and distant to it.
